Top 5 Train Games on iOS in Norway Q2 2024
Discover the performance of the top 5 train games on iOS in Norway for Q2 2024, including trends in downloads, revenue, and weekly active users.
The second quarter of 2024 saw a variety of performance trends among the top 5 train games on the iOS platform in Norway. These metrics include downloads, revenue, and weekly active users, all sourced from Sensor Tower.
Train Station 2: Steam Empire by Pixel Federation Games showed fluctuating revenue, peaking at $819 in early May. Downloads were generally low, with a notable spike to 108 in early June. Weekly active users started at 711 in April, dipping to 506 by late May, and rebounding to 760 in June.
Thomas & Friends: Go Go Thomas from Budge Studios experienced consistent revenue growth, peaking at $429 in late April. Downloads remained minimal, with a significant increase to 30 in mid-June. Weekly active users fluctuated, starting at 45 in April and peaking at 50 in mid-June.
Thomas & Friends Minis, also by Budge Studios, saw revenue peak at $498 in late June. Downloads were generally low, with a peak of 32 in early June. Weekly active users varied, peaking at 59 in early June.
Thomas & Friends: Magic Tracks demonstrated steady revenue, peaking at $497 in mid-June. Downloads were minimal, with no significant spikes. Weekly active users data was sparse, showing only 10 in early April.
Train Miner: Idle Railway Game by AI Games FZ had consistent revenue, peaking at $179 in mid-June. Downloads were robust, with a peak of 440 in mid-May. Weekly active users were strong, starting at 808 in April and peaking at 944 in mid-May.
